What is ADHD?
ADHD is characterized by a consistent pattern of negligence and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that hinders functioning or advancement. The condition is considered to be highly hereditary, although environmental factors might likewise play a function. Understanding ADHD is important since early diagnosis can cause effective management methods.

Are free ADHD tests accurate?
Free ADHD tests can be considered screening tools, however they are not diagnostic tools. They might offer initial insights, but a professional evaluation is needed for a definitive diagnosis.
2. Can ADHD go undiagnosed in adults?
Yes, ADHD Adult Test can in some cases go unnoticed in adults, particularly if they display symptoms without considerable hyperactivity, which can lead to confusion with other concerns such as anxiety or anxiety.
3. What role does ADHD testing play in a kid's education?
ADHD testing can supply insights that empower educators to execute the ideal methods in academic settings. This can include lodgings such as extra time on tests or preferential seating.
4. Can I take an ADHD test online?
Yes, many trusted sites use free tests for adults and children. Constantly make sure that you're using reputable sources for these assessments, and seek expert evaluation later.
5. Are there any dangers of taking a free ADHD test?
The main risks include misconception of the results if they are taken out of context. In addition, questions might not consider comorbid conditions that could also impact symptoms.
